Using Cursors:
DECLARE @date_key INT
DECLARE date_cursor CURSOR FOR
SELECT date_key FROM dim_date WHERE [year] = 2013 ORDER BY date_key
OPEN date_cursor
FETCH NEXT FROM date_cursor INTO @date_key
WHILE @@FETCH_STATUS = 0
BEGIN
SELECT @date_key
--Insert code by @date_key here
FETCH NEXT FROM date_cursor INTO @date_key
END
CLOSE date_cursor
DEALLOCATE date_cursor

Collation Conflict between databases (tempdb and user databases)
Msg 468, Level 16, State 9, Line 21
Cannot resolve the collation conflict between "Latin1_General_CI_AS" and "SQL_Latin1_General_CP1_CI_AS" in the equal to operation.
Use the COLLATE DATABASE_DEFAULT suffix on VARCHAR columns:
SELECT *
FROM hif_dim_account AS a
INNER JOIN #temp_hierarchy AS t
ON t.account COLLATE DATABASE_DEFAULT = a.account COLLATE DATABASE_DEFAULT
INNER JOIN hif_dim_hierarchy AS h ON h.business_description COLLATE DATABASE_DEFAULT = t.business_description COLLATE DATABASE_DEFAULT

Row Counts for All Tables in a Database
IF OBJECT_ID('tempdb..#T','U') IS NOT NULL DROP TABLE #T
GO
CREATE TABLE #T (TableName nvarchar(500),NumberOfRows int)
GO
INSERT INTO #T
EXEC sp_msForEachTable 'SELECT PARSENAME(''?'', 1) as TableName,COUNT(*) as NumberOfRows FROM ?'
GO
SELECT * FROM #T ORDER BY NumberOfRows DESC
GO

Search Schema for Text (eg. column names)
SELECT DISTINCT OBJECT_NAME(id) AS ObjectName
FROM syscomments WHERE [text] LIKE '%business_day%'
ORDER BY 1

Select Date Formats Using CONVERT() Function
SELECT date_key
,date
,DAY(date) AS month
,MONTH(date) AS month
,YEAR(date) AS year
,CONVERT(CHAR(4),date,100) + CONVERT(CHAR(4),date,120) AS a
,CONVERT(CHAR(10),date,103) AS b
,CONVERT(CHAR(11),date,113) AS c
,CONVERT(CHAR(10),date,120) AS d
,CONVERT(CHAR(11),date,112) AS e
FROM dim_date
WHERE year = 2012
Concatenate Using FOR XML
SELECT STUFF((
SELECT ',' AS [text()], CAST(month_name AS NVARCHAR(30)) AS [text()]
--SELECT *
FROM dim_date
WHERE date >= '2013-01-31' AND date <= '2013-12-31' AND date = last_day_of_month
FOR XML PATH('')
), 1, 1, '') AS months

List of Month Names Using CTE
WITH CTEMonth
AS
(
SELECT 1 AS month_number
UNION ALL
SELECT month_number + 1 FROM CTEMonth WHERE month_number <= 11
)
SELECT month_number,DATENAME(MONTH, DATEADD(MONTH, month_number, 0) - 1) [month_name] FROM CTEMonth
